Most people don’t realize a sunburn can occur in under 15 minutes! Guest Info Richard Craig Bezozo, M.D. is President of MoleSafe U.S.A., where he helps direct all operational and service logistics. In addition to his role in day-to-day responsibilities, Dr. Bezozo is an influential force behind the expansion of MoleSafe facilities in the U.S. MoleSafe services provide a special imaging technology, dermoscopy, which can help to detect early skin cancer, specifically melanoma. In addition to MoleSafe, Dr. Bezozo is currently also CEO and full-time physician at Care Station Medical Group of New Jersey. He is a consultant on current issues including, Occupational Medicine, Occupational work practices, controlling healthcare costs and improving outcomes and drugs in the workplace. An active member of the American College of Occupational and Environmental Medicine, Dr. Bezozo was a board member and founder of the Urgent Cares of New Jersey as well as a board member of the New Jersey Workers Compensation Education Association. He is also a Regional Medical Director for major companies throughout New Jersey. Dr. Bezozo attended Alfred University and in 1979 received a B.A. degree from the C.W. Post Center at Long Island University. In 1983 he earned his M.D. from St. Georges University School of Medicine. Website Host Dr. Derrick DeSilva Show Date 2009-05-05 |
